Drug and Alcohol Testing Information
... • A “cutoff” is the concentration of analyte (drug) in a urine sample at or above which the sample is considered positive for that drug. Basal Ganglia and Associated Pathways
... The nigrostriatal pathway is a connection between the substantia nigra pars compacta and the striatum. It is a source of input into the basal ganglia (striatum) and serves as a modulatory pathway of the direct and indirect basal ganglia pathways.
